December Birthdays

 I have a couple of family birthdays this week, so I pulled out one of the panels I made last summer using the Butterflies stamps and stencils (I made up several extra stamped panels in different colourways - for exactly this reason, to pull out when needed!), and fussy cut out the butterflies.

For this card I used the Diagonal Stitched Plaid Cover die on some aqua cardstock as the base, then die cut the Stitched Scallop Rectangles die in some fine, sparkly silver cardstock.  I glued the butterfly down with a gem for it's head, and added one of the Perfect Sentiments with some 3D foam tape.
My second card uses the Eyelet Cover Die from Pigment Craft Company on aqua cardstock, trimmed to show just a hint of white around the edges.  I die cut the smaller Stitched Scallop Rectangle die from the same glittery cardstock and added another Perfect Sentiment with foam tape.

They're wonderfully sparkly in person!  All supplies are Pinkfresh Studio, except where noted.
